## Tuning

The Pellora transcoding farm balances throughput against per-job latency. Before changing worker counts, confirm that the queue depth alarm has been quiet for at least an hour, since shortened segment lengths can mask backlog. Support should adjust only the documented knobs and record each change in the shift log. Start from the defaults shown in the table below.

constants for tafog-kahag:
RATE_LIMITS = {
    "sorir": 697,
    "oliox": 683,
    "holax": 176,
    "casox": 60,
    "pelius": 382,
}

Action item: The Relayn deploy-status bot silently dropped updates when the pipeline API paginated results, so responders believed a rollback had completed when it had not. We will add pagination handling, a staleness banner, and an integration test. Until merged, verify deploy state directly in the pipeline console, documented at the page below.

runbook for kahop-kajop: https://rundeck.ordinio.test/display/secrets/pipeline/issue/pages/repo/browse/e5732776e07d1285107e5aeb

### Notes — Ledgerline ORM Refactor Sync

Agreed to peel the legacy ORM layer off in three phases: read paths first, then writes, then the migration shims. No new code may import `ormlegacy` directly; use the repository interfaces instead. New team members should pair on their first refactor PR. Weekly progress reviews continue Thursdays. Overall accountability for the refactor sits with one named owner.

named custodian: Brivan Eliath Quenox Frador

Leadership Review Briefing — Harrowgate Lease

Quick update for you: we've reopened talks with the landlord at our Harrowgate site, since the current terms date from the expansion days and we're using barely half the floor. Priya from facilities thinks we can cut rent by a fifth if we commit to five years. Worth deciding before month-end. The wider plan this supports is set out just below.

management briefing: Project Ulavan slips by two quarters because of the staffing delay.